Products
GG网络技术分享 2025-05-08 09:52 3
探索Charts.js动态数据展示的无限可能
数据可视化已成为理解和分析数据的关键环节。而Charts.js,作为一款强大且流行的JavaScript图表库,正是帮助开发者实现数据可视化的重要工具。
一、Charts.js简介Charts.js是一个开源、轻量级的JavaScript图表库,它基于HTML5的Canvas元素进行绘制。它提供了多种图表类型,包括柱状图、折线图、饼图等,能满足各种数据可视化的需求。其简洁的API设计让开发者能够轻松将其集成到各种Web项目中。
要使用Charts.js, 需要确保开发环境具备基本的Web开发条件。你可以使用文本编辑器如Visual Studio Code,以及本地服务器环境如XAMPP。接着,通过CDN引入Charts.js库文件到HTML文件中,即可开始创建图表。
三、常见图表示例
html
const ctx = document.getElementById.getContext;
const myChart = new Chart(ctx, {
type: 'bar',
data: {
labels: ,
datasets: ,
backgroundColor: ,
borderColor: ,
borderWidth: 1
}]
},
options: {
scales: {
y: {
beginAtZero: true
}
}
}
});
Charts.js允许开发者对图表进行高度自定义的样式设置和交互配置。你可以通过CSS修改canvas元素的样式,或者使用Charts.js提供的回调函数来实现更复杂的交互逻辑,如点击事件处理、鼠标悬停显示详细信息等。
五、常见问题解答问:如何在同一图表中显示多个数据集? 答:在Charts.js的data对象的datasets数组中添加多个对象即可,每个对象代表一个数据集,可以设置不同的数据、标签、颜色等属性。
问:如何自定义图表的标题和图例位置? 答:可以通过options对象的plugins属性来更改标题和图例位置。
Charts.js以其简单易用、功能强大的特点,成为众多开发者在进行数据可视化时的首选工具。通过本文的介绍,希望你能快速上手,创建出满足各种需求的精美图表。在实际项目中,不断探索和尝试其丰富的功能和自定义选项,将有助于你更好地展示数据,挖掘数据背后的价值,为决策提供有力的支持。
欢迎用实际体验验证观点,让我们共同探索数据可视化的无限可能。
Demand feedback